Output 333efc6cf69fad40e335bed095451357edd57be41c5d901f644a07cc3de92614:0

value
23504
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4babe5601716b39ad2985c3e710c63a8177a2fde OP_EQUALVERIFY OP_CHECKSIG
address
17u7bvySPQ8o8Y61oYqYoYfW3PepDGxMTu
transaction
333efc6cf69fad40e335bed095451357edd57be41c5d901f644a07cc3de92614
spent
true